SCSU Men's Soccer Plays To 0-0 Tie at Franklin Pierce

Box Score RINDGE, N.H.-- Southern Connecticut men's soccer played to a 0-0 tie in a Northeast 10 conference matchup against Franklin Pierce University on Saturday. With the draw, The Owls move to 5-2-3 overall and 3-0-2 in the NE10, while Franklin Pierce moves to 5-2-2 overall and 3-0-1 in the NE10. 

It was a defensive battle between the Owls and the Ravens with both sides only taking three shots on goal each. The Owls shots came from Jake Novoshelski, Sam Sandler and Amos Bignotti

Owls goalkeeper Diego Flores continued to build on a strong season. Coming off of his first NE10 goalkeeper of the week award, the freshman had three saves on his way to pitching his sixth straight shutout, not allowing a goal since Sept. 19. 

Southern Connecticut is back in action on Tuesday Oct. 14 when they travel to Rockville Centre, N.Y to take on Molloy University in a non-conference game at 4 pm. The Owls then return to Jess Dow Field on Saturday Oct. 18 to host Saint Michael's College in a NE10 conference match up at 4 PM.
